Mission

Gifts for Seniors provides inclusive programs to alleviate the devastating health impacts of social isolation for over 7,000 older adults annually. Recipients represent 16 cultural and ethnic communities. 100% are low-income or on a fixed budget due to age or disability and 96% identify as having limited social opportunities. Our programs include basic needs (clothing, linens, appliances, medical/household/personal hygiene supplies, mind-sharpening activities, winter gear, etc.), food stability, cards & art, tech devices, social visits, referrals for community supports, and digital literacy education.

Program Service Accomplishments

Program 1
Expenses: $512,059

Gifts for Seniors provided 16,847 community resource bundles valued at $390,971 during year-round life-affirming social visits. These resources were gifted to over 7,049 socially isolated older adults in need. Donations are received from over 200 corporate partners and thousands of individuals passionate about alleviating loneliness and caring for our older adult neighbors. Each gift comes with a handwritten card made by volunteers through the Cards for Seniors initiative with the goal of fostering human connection. Gifts for Seniors meets its social mission by partnering with over 140 aging services partners to inspire joy throughout the community. Our success is not possible without the engagement and support of our amazing fleet of dedicated volunteers who gifted over 2,777 service hours.
